  • Abstract
    Describes a PC/Windows real-time system that uses an advanced data acquisition processor to analyse surface EMG signals. The system is able to calculate time- and frequency domain parameters of surface EMGs during static and repeated isokinetic contractions with a high degree of standardisation. Using a database and Windows/DDE gives flexible opportunity to additional processing. Selection of parameters as well as implementation of future parameters is easy to perform, since the system is software-based
